[quote=Anonymous]I had an unplanned c section and it was much easier than I thought it would be. There’s a long time between baby being born and you being able to see them. They stitch you up before you can hold baby and that process felt interminable to me- maybe 20 minutes but torture bc I could hear her crying and couldn’t see her. There is a lot of people in the room as a matter of course- anesthesiologist, OB, nurses, pediatrician. I was surprised but it’s normal apparently. You shouldn’t feel pain but you will feel a lot of pressure- it’s a very odd feeling like they are pushing you down to get the baby out. I took Colace in the hospital (not before because it wasn’t planned) and my first poop was fine. NBD. My scar is really low, below the hair line, and, 2 years out, I can hardly see it. And I do still have no feeling in part of my lower abdomen. My core strength was ruined post C section and took a long time to rebuild. I seriously had trouble even like sitting up in bed.[/quote]
